我正在使用PaginatedDataTable小部件来显示我的数据,它从一开始就需要所有数据。例如,我想要每页10个条目,并且我有100个数据记录(条目(,因此小部件需要100个数据纪录才能构建UI。但该项目在大量数据记录方面具有巨大潜力。
有没有一种方法(或其他小部件(可以通过多请求构建一个分页表(每次从db(调用api(更改页面时提取(,以避免在我们尝试一次提取所有数据时长时间加载?
在应用程序中获取大数据会影响性能,从而影响用户体验。
您可以使用infinite pagination
或custom pagination list
实现分页逻辑
为此,分页逻辑必须在服务器中实现,响应应包含总页码和当前页码以及数据
您可以在pub.dev 中找到一些用于无限分页的有用软件包
非常感谢您的回答。(Suz Zan(我发现了一些具有easy_Page_datable小部件结构的包,但最后我决定构建我的一个分页表小部件!(完全自定义(。